Spitalfields Music Grant 2013 - 2015

Report of the Director of Culture, Heritage and Libraries (copy attached).

Minutes:

The Committee considered a report of the Director of Culture, Heritage and Libraries seeking approval to fund Spitalfields Music for 2013/14, 2014/15 and 2015/16 with a grant of £45,000 per annum.

 

The Chairman welcomed the report and added that he was impressed with the money raising ability of Spitalfields Music and the accomplishments that schools and children had achieved through the organisation.

 

In response to a Members question, the Chief Executive of Spitalfields Music informed the Committee of a particularly successful project the organisation had undertaken where musicians had been taken into the Royal London Hospital for a period of 10 weeks to compose special lullabies with the intention of soothing difficult births and bringing new-born babies and their families closer together. She added that this project had provided some early evidence that music aided babies’ recoveries.

 

RESOLVED – That the Finance Committee be recommended to fund Spitalfields Music for 2013/14, 2014/15 and 2015/16 with a grant of £45,000 per annum which represents a 10% cut to the previous level of grant to the organisation, in line with that applied to other City arts organisations.
